I have a 9300 and I use it for my HTPC hooked up to a 27" LCDTV. I use the external monitor with the laptop closed. It took me a few days of tweaking to figure out the only way to get this working for me was to use the 8040 drivers, any other driver would turn off the screen once I closed the monitor.
8040 has other problems, such as odd shading in Psychonauts, but overal works great.

What I want to do is setup the external display to be the only monitor on boot.
I can easily set this up after it has booted, using the Display Properties, or the CRT/LCD button. But it is too complicated for my wife. Is there anyway to get it to DEFAULT using the external monitor, not requiring me to change the settings after starting up? This might require some script running on startup, but I havn't done such a thing before, any insight would be useful.

I have thought about just leaving it on all the time, because when it comes back from standby it is still on the second monitor. But I think it would not be wise for me to keep it running 24/7, it might wear out years sooner than normal.

I am using mine as a htpc. Try to set it up so that you use a program called powerstrip. Set it up so that everything works on the second monitor with Ps
turn of the laptop monitor. I dont know how that that is done with the nvidia I use the ati x300. Powerstrip can autorun on startup with windows and you shoul start exactly where you endet when you turned your 9300 off.

I use my 9300 as htpc on my nec pg10. I when everything is set and the pg10 is my primary screen set perfectly with ps (and the laptopdisplay turned off) . I can shut the 9300 down and use it elsewhere as a normall laptop, when I come home, I plug in the pg10,turn on the 9300 and everything is htpc again.

I had some problems in the beginning because the ati x300m was not able to work with powerstrip, but the guys in Taiwan fixed that. At least for the ati catalyst 5.6 with 5.7 I still have some problems.
Lets hope that powerstrip supports the nvidia card.
